Introduction
The Electric Pickup Vehicle Market is gaining rapid traction as the automotive industry shifts toward sustainable transportation and zero-emission mobility solutions. Electric pickup trucks combine utility, towing capability, and rugged performance with the environmental benefits of electric powertrains. Initially dominated by SUVs and sedans, the EV landscape is now expanding into commercial and lifestyle pickup segments, appealing to individuals, businesses, and fleet operators. These vehicles are equipped with high-capacity batteries, powerful electric motors, and advanced features such as regenerative braking, connected driving systems, and fast-charging capability. The market is projected to grow at a CAGR of around 12–15% over the forecast period, driven by government incentives, rising fuel prices, rapid charging infrastructure development, and evolving consumer preference for clean, powerful, and tech-advanced pickups. As major automakers enter the electric pickup space, competitive pricing, innovative designs, and enhanced range performance are shaping the evolution of this market.

Market Drivers
Increasing demand for zero-emission commercial and personal mobility solutions is a key driver for electric pickup adoption. Government incentives, tax credits, and strict CO₂ emission regulations are accelerating EV penetration. Rising fuel prices and the need to reduce fleet operating costs are encouraging logistics and utility companies to shift toward electric pickup fleets. Growing consumer interest in high-performance, connected, and low-maintenance vehicles is fueling demand. Advancements in battery technology are enabling longer driving ranges, faster charging, and improved durability. Major automotive manufacturers expanding EV portfolios with electric pickup models are boosting market visibility and consumer confidence. Additionally, increasing corporate sustainability commitments are driving commercial fleet electrification across construction, agriculture, and delivery sectors.

Market Challenges
High initial purchase cost of electric pickups due to expensive battery packs limits adoption in cost-sensitive markets. Limited charging infrastructure, especially in rural regions where pickups are widely used, restricts long-distance usability. Payload and towing performance of some electric pickups may decline with heavy loads, impacting range and efficiency. Battery degradation over time raises long-term ownership concerns. Limited model availability in certain markets slows mass adoption. Cold climate performance issues affecting range and efficiency pose challenges for users in harsh weather regions. Additionally, higher battery weight influences vehicle dynamics and may reduce off-road performance if not optimized.

Market Opportunities
Increasing development of fast-charging networks and home charging solutions offers strong growth opportunities. Expansion of electric pickup offerings into fleet operations—such as utilities, mining, and commercial logistics—creates large-scale demand. Integration of vehicle-to-grid (V2G) and vehicle-to-load (V2L) features allows electric pickups to supply power to homes, tools, and external devices, opening new use-case scenarios. Lightweight materials, solid-state batteries, and high-efficiency motors present innovation potential for enhanced performance and range. Growing popularity of recreational and lifestyle pickup use—camping, adventure travel, and outdoor activities—supports market expansion. Emerging markets in Asia, Latin America, and the Middle East are beginning to adopt electric pickups for commercial fleets and sustainable farming. Strategic partnerships between automakers, battery manufacturers, and charging companies will accelerate product affordability and adoption.

Regional Insights
North America dominates the Electric Pickup Vehicle Market, driven by strong pickup culture, high demand for utility vehicles, and presence of leading EV manufacturers in the U.S. and Canada. The U.S. is the largest market due to early model launches and government EV incentives. Europe shows increasing adoption supported by emission-free transportation policies, adoption in construction fleets, and rising preference for sustainable mobility across Germany, the UK, Norway, and France. Asia-Pacific is growing rapidly due to EV expansion in China, South Korea, and emerging interest in electric utility vehicles in India and Australia. China is investing heavily in electric commercial vehicles and pickup electrification. Latin America and the Middle East show emerging potential as governments begin promoting EV adoption in commercial and off-road applications.
